YMCA bank league points as they show they’re up for the cup

NEWPORT YMCA prepared for their forthcoming Welsh Cup showdown with Bangor by coming from behind to secure a 2-1 victory at Maesteg Park.

Daniel Nash gave Maesteg the advantage after 25 minutes, but a minute later Leighton Burrows levelled matters and a Daniel Heath header in the closing stages gave the YMCA the points.

Ton Pentre’s title hopes were dealt a blow when they lost 2-0 at home to Dinas Powys. Jason Cowan scored the first Dinas goal and there was an own goal.

A Chris Pearce goal gave Caerleon a 1-0 win at home to Cwmbran.
